Skip to content

dermatologist/openmrs-module-opspost

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

43 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

openmrs-module-opspost

Openmrs-module-opspost is a module for allowing patients to post observations to their own records. This module is for use with openmrs-suite-dermatology for uploading images for online dermatology consultation from a mobile app.

How this works

  • Install this module.
  • You can generate a key for any patient in the patient chart. Share the key with the patient for entering in his/her mobile app.
  • Create a role that has privileges on this module ONLY.
  • The mobile app sends a request as the above user with the patient’s unique key (openmrs/rest/v1/opspost/{apikey})
  • If the unique key exists, this module returns a session ID with the necessary previledges (set in settings).
  • Post the observation/image with the sessionID.
  • A sample mobile app is available here.

This is an experimental application that can make OpenMRS insecure.

DO NOT USE this in production

About

Post obs to OpenMRS without login (For mHealth Apps and sensors)

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published